#[derive(Debug, Serialize, Deserialize, Clone, PartialEq, Eq)]
|
||||
pub enum Criterion {
|
||||
/// Sorted by decreasing number of matched query terms.
|
||||
/// Query words at the front of an attribute is considered better than if it was at the back.
|
||||
Words,
|
||||
/// Sorted by increasing number of typos.
|
||||
Typo,
|
||||
/// Sorted by increasing distance between matched query terms.
|
||||
Proximity,
|
||||
/// Documents with quey words contained in more important
|
||||
/// attributes are considered better.
|
||||
Attribute,
|
||||
/// Dynamically sort at query time the documents. None, one or multiple Asc/Desc sortable
|
||||
/// attributes can be used in place of this criterion at query time.
|
||||
Sort,
|
||||
/// Sorted by the similarity of the matched words with the query words.
|
||||
Exactness,
|
||||
/// Sorted by the increasing value of the field specified.
|
||||
Asc(String),
|
||||
/// Sorted by the decreasing value of the field specified.
|
||||
Desc(String),
|
||||
}
